Blackburn council leader objects to car sales lot
2:22pm Wednesday 19th December 2012 in News
BLACKBURN with Darwen council leader Kate Hollern and her Wensley Fold ward Labour colleague Mohammed Khan have objected to a backdated planning application for a car sales lot.
Aman Ullah Qamar is seeking retrospective permission to use the site in Wensley Road for his Wensley Motors business. Officials have recommended the borough planning committee to approve the application despite the objections.
Couns Hollern and Khan are worried about traffic on the narrow road, parking, obstruction of a bus route and disturbance to residents.
